Sumario:This research has as objective to determine the frequency of use of thinking routines in the teaching - learning process of Mathematics by teachers of the Third Year of the Unified General Baccalaureate of the Fiscal Educational Unit "Arturo Borja" in the school year 2018-2019, with the proposal to suggest a constructivist and innovative methodological procedure, starting from an articulated and technical bibliographic analysis whose theoretical foundations allowed the conceptual scaffolding of thought routines with constructivism as a teaching philosophy.
